Course form can be absolutely crucial when looking for a winner. If you know your way around a place, you are going to have an advantage over somebody who has never been there before. The same applies to horses – knowing your way around a venue is always a big advantage. Adrian Wall has picked out three former course winners running on ITV on Saturday.

Boombawn is a perfect two from two around Kempton and he’s massively overpriced at current odds. Dan Skelton’s runner won a Grade 2 at Wincanton in November when seeing off a subsequent winner, while he had excuses for a below-par run at Newbury last time when making a big error as the race was starting to hot up.
Choosethenews could land the Eider Chase. He won here over 2m4f last spring and looked like he would relish a test like this when runner-up here over 2m7f last time out. He’s on an upward trajectory and is off a fair mark so everything looks set for a big run again.
Our Power won this premier chase two years ago and he’s back for more again. Sam Thomas has a brilliant strike-rate this season to date and this lad arrives here off the back of two fine seconds. He’s off a high enough mark but looks set to be involved in the finish again. Dylan Johnston is excellent value for his 3lb claim.
